How can a VPN help you?

Introduction: In today's digital age, where online privacy and security are paramount, using a Virtual Private Network (VPN) has become increasingly popular. While VPNs were initially associated with businesses and tech-savvy individuals, they have now become essential tools for everyday users. In this blog post, we'll explore the reasons why using a VPN as an everyday user can greatly benefit your online experience.

  1. Enhanced Security: One of the primary advantages of using a VPN is the enhanced security it provides. When you connect to a VPN, it encrypts your internet traffic, creating a secure tunnel between your device and the VPN server. This encryption shields your data from prying eyes, such as hackers and cybercriminals, even when you're connected to public Wi-Fi networks. By using a VPN, you significantly reduce the risk of falling victim to data breaches and identity theft.

  2. Privacy Protection: Using a VPN also helps protect your online privacy. Internet service providers (ISPs), government agencies, and even certain websites often track your online activities. With a VPN, your IP address is masked, making it difficult for anyone to monitor your online behavior. VPNs also prevent websites from tracking your location and gathering personal information, ensuring your privacy remains intact.

  3. Bypassing Geo-Restrictions: Many online platforms and services have geo-restrictions in place, limiting access to specific content based on your geographical location. By connecting to a VPN server in a different country, you can bypass these restrictions and access content that might be otherwise unavailable in your region. Whether it's streaming services, social media platforms, or websites with regional limitations, a VPN grants you the freedom to explore the internet without limitations.

  4. Safely Access Public Wi-Fi: Public Wi-Fi networks are convenient, but they often pose significant security risks. Hackers can easily intercept your data on unsecured networks, potentially gaining access to sensitive information like passwords and financial details. By using a VPN on public Wi-Fi, you create a secure connection that encrypts your data, ensuring that your online activities remain private and protected.

  5. Anonymity and Freedom of Expression: In countries where internet censorship is prevalent, a VPN can provide a lifeline for freedom of expression. By encrypting your internet traffic and masking your IP address, a VPN allows you to access blocked websites, communicate securely, and express your opinions without fear of surveillance or reprisal.

Conclusion: In conclusion, using a VPN as an everyday user offers numerous benefits. From bolstering your online security and privacy to bypassing geo-restrictions and accessing a freer internet, a VPN empowers you to take control of your online experience. As the digital landscape continues to evolve, incorporating a reliable VPN service into your daily routine is an effective way to safeguard your data, protect your privacy, and navigate the internet with confidence.
